Average Game Play: Ladder toss (also known as ladder ball, monkey ball, ladder golf, ball rope, goofy balls, cowboy golf, and hillbilly golf and other names) is a lawn game played by throwing bolas (two balls connected by a string) onto a ladder. Ladder toss, also known as ladder ball or ladder golf, is a lawn game that can be played one-on-one or in two teams of two players. Bola, also called Bolas, (Spanish: "balls"; from boleadoras), South American Indianweapon, primarily used for hunting, consisting of stone balls, usually in a group of three, attached to long, slender ropes. This game is played in rounds, meaning that the players or teams toss 3 bolas on each of their turns.
Delivery & Services. In order to win, a player must be the only one to score exactly 21 points after the completion of a round. The players can knock off other bolas, or even throw them onto the same rung as another to hurt their opponent's score.
